Spatial variability in fMRI for conscious tactile perception
Marc Pabst, Alice Dabbagh, Till Nierhaus, Arno Villringer & Martin Grund
Previous fMRI research on conscious tactile perception has focused on activity amplitudes instead of utilizing the spatial patterns. In the visual domain, low (spatial) variability of neural responses has been discussed as a marker of stimulus awareness. Here, we take a similar approach to tactile stimulation by investigating trial-to-trial variability of activation patterns as a measure of variability in neural representation.
